The main advantage of grid-tied solar inverters is that they allow solar energy systems to work in tandem with the existing utility grid. Solar panels create direct current (DC) power, while most homes and businesses use alternating current (AC) current to power their appliances. The inverter is responsible for converting DC electricity into AC power, which can be used on-site. This process allows solar energy to be used by homeowners, all while ensuring a seamless connection to the electrical grid.
Also, grid-tied inverters are engineered to match the output to the grid frequency so that the system can be used with the grid. This synchronization enables energy to flow to the grid and from the grid in an efficient and dependable manner.
Bidirectional power flow is one of the most significant benefits of grid-tied solar inverters. Excessive power from the solar panels is fed into the grid when more energy is generated than is consumed. Homeowners can then benefit from net metering programs that credit them for energy fed back into the grid.
On the other hand, when solar energy production falls short (on cloudy days, or at nighttime), the inverter provides the option for the home (or business) to draw power from the grid and maintain a steady flow of electricity. Maximum Power Point Tracking (MPPT) technology is built into grid-tied solar inverters, and it specifically improves the energy harvest efficiency of the solar panels. By adjusting the operating point of the solar panels for voltage and current condition, MPPT makes sure that the inverter works on the maximum power point. This means that the inverter is drawing as much power as possible from the solar panels and is maximizing available sunlight.
MPPT enhances solar energy efficiency and provides higher energy yield for the homeowner or business by constantly tracking and adjusting to the optimum energy point. This means that less energy is used on wasted energy, which translates to higher energy savings over time.
With net metering, grid-tied solar can save you a significant amount on your energy bill. The solar system feeds power back into the grid, and the utility company provides a credit for this power dashboard. These credits allow the excess authorized solar production to offset the electricity drawn from the grid when solar generation is low, such as on cloudy days or at night.
In areas that offer net metering, the savings can be significant. By using solar energy during the day and tapping into the grid at night, at potentially discounted rates, homeowners could rid themselves entirely of their monthly electricity bills, only paying for the net energy used (though costs vary).
